热文springboot项目使用@LogRecord注解统一打印日志 我们在工作中无论如何都会使用到日志打印的需求,如果公司没有一个统一的日志采集平台,同时没有相关的规范的话,大家打印日志的话就会是这种方式,五花八门,例如:对于上面这种日志的话,我们使用起来,如果系统出现问题,我们只能... Raejava2022-10-131275 阅读0 评论
热文Springboot中使用的redisUtils工具类 在java项目里面经常使用到redis,同时目前java项目绝大多数都是基于springboot做脚手架的,因此这篇文章我们介绍下RedisUtils工具类,并且介绍下如何融入springboot项目中。一、引入ma... Raejava2022-10-111007 阅读0 评论
spring-boot项目如何配置定时器任务并进行动态更新 我们经常需要使用到定时器任务,现在spring一统天下的局面,spring-boot几乎都是我们工作中必须使用的项目框架模式。今天就来介绍一篇使用spring-boot项目编写定时器任务并且动态更新执行时间的案例。一... Rae开发语言2022-09-26870 阅读0 评论
热文推荐一个redis的可视化工具-RedisInsight 今天给大家推荐一个redis的可视化工具-RedisInsight。这个工具是一个直观高效的Redis GUI管理工具。这个工具有如下优点:1、他可以对redis的内存,连接数,命中率及日常运行进行监控 2、他是唯一... 帅平java2022-09-241118 阅读0 评论
热文实战spring-boot操作minio文件系统 在上一篇文章《minio单机docker安装》我们介绍了minio的安装,在本篇文章,我们直接实战一下spring-boot操作minio文件系统的demo一、创建一个maven项目,并且导入依赖 Rae开发语言2022-09-241095 阅读0 评论
热文实战Spring-boot项目集成多数据源 最近有小伙伴咨询,现在的数据多样化,可能一部分的数据存储在A地方,一部分数据存储在B地方,这样子的话,就会涉及到同一个单一的应用业务里面去多个数据源里面进行查询。然后我去网上查了一下,像这种情况还是蛮多的,例如:医疗... Rae开发语言2022-09-221109 阅读1 评论
sentinel的流控规则/降级规则/热点规则/系统规则/授权规则的配置与说明 前面我们介绍了一夏spring cloud项目集成sentinel的方式方法,我们可以看到直接在nacos里面配置对应的规则,那么我们在这里介绍下对应的规则配置如何做,还有各个参数代表什么意思。流控规则1)字段说明序... Rae开发语言2022-09-19820 阅读0 评论
热文Mybatis操作数据库,如何配置数据库密码加密 还是一样的,最近需要系统三级等保抽查,所以需要对系统进行整改。这篇文章我们主要介绍下在生产环境,我们的数据库密码不应该是用明文配置的,需要使用加密后的密文进行交互。因此这里我们还是在前面文章的例子上直接进行改造,在配... Rae开发语言2022-09-181074 阅读0 评论
热文如何使用mybatis plus实现字段自动加解密存储和查询 最近遇到上面检查,要求所有的系统进行三级等保检查。由于前期在项目中开发的时候,这样的需求没有提过,所以现在需要紧急进行处理下。今天我们就来演示下对系统做小范围的修改,满足三级等保的要求,实现数据库里面的敏感字段加解密... Rae开发语言2022-09-181164 阅读0 评论
JAVA如何使用注解初始化ftpclient 最近看公司老的项目,由于是内部项目,所以文件存储服务器使用了fastdfs。在检查他们代码的时候,看到初始化ftpclient的时候都是使用的文件进行读取。ClientGlobal.init(this.getClas... Rae开发语言2022-09-17790 阅读0 评论
热文JAVA如何操作minio文件系统 MinIO Java Client SDK提供简单的API来访问任何与Amazon S3兼容的对象存储服务。最低需求Java 1.8或更高版本:使用mavenCopy io.... Rae开发语言2022-09-161163 阅读0 评论
实战使用sharding-jdbc框架让程序自动进行主从读写分离 上一篇文章《如何使用docker搭建一个mysql5.7的主从环境》我们使用docker的方式搭建了一个mysql5.7的master-slave模式,在这里我们java程序演示下如何做到自动入库的时候向master... Rae开发语言2022-09-15946 阅读0 评论
热文spring-retry进行task的重试如此简单 在项目项目里面我们会涉及到调用第三方,那么调用第三方的时候经常会出现第三方不稳定的情况,此时我们程序就会出现错误。不严谨的程序遇到错误就会停止继续往下走,严谨一点的程序就会写很多的循环加上重试等,今天我们介绍一个经常... Rae开发语言2022-08-251067 阅读0 评论
热文 etcd分布式锁讲解(二)etcd分布式锁的执行流程 上一篇我们简单的介绍一下,etcd的分布式锁java代码,同时也运行了测试过程。在这里我们结合代码来说说etcd分布式锁的执行流程在etcd分布式锁的执行流程里面,我们主要分为7个步骤1、建立连接 2、创建一个唯一的... Raejava2022-08-191188 阅读0 评论
热文etcd分布式锁讲解(一)etcd分布式锁java演示 在秒杀的文章系列里面我们介绍了使用redis做分布式锁在大型的高并发场景里面是不合适的,主要是由于redis的集群同步的问题。所以当时给大家建议的是使用etcd来做分布式锁。etcd的分布式锁在单机的环境下,每秒QP... Raejava2022-08-191387 阅读0 评论